The Poem (from the Soul)



did it come from the soul,
did it shine though the dark,
did it open a world
and a great truth impart?

then you have succeeded

though in heaven, as you
can imagine, just one word won't
do, no not five or ten too -
all in right places and chosen

and moseying along at a good
pace and sounding okay, or
raisin' a  commotion with notion -

the spirit being a multi-factor aled
thing, just chooses to sing -
with any notes, words, emotes
on all at it's use... no barrier reef

causin' grief - head tryin' to think
